Janice Radway is an American literary and cultural studies scholar.

She served as an editor of American Quarterly, and, in 1998-99, as president of the American Studies Association. In 2008, she became Walter Dill Scott Professor of Communication Studies at Northwestern University

Scholarly impact

Radway is very widely known for her scholarship on readers and reading in the contexts of romance novels, middlebrow culture, and American studies.
